1. Myth: Liquid nose jobs are extremely expensive
Fact: One common myth is that liquid nose jobs cost a fortune. However, when compared to traditional rhinoplasty, they are generally more affordable. Liquid nose jobs involve using dermal fillers to shape and contour the nose, eliminating the need for surgery and reducing costs associated with anesthesia, operating rooms, and a lengthy recovery period.
The cost of a liquid nose job varies depending on factors such as the expertise of the provider, the amount of filler required, and your geographical location. On average, it can range from $500 to $2,500, making it a more budget-friendly option for those considering nasal enhancement.
If you're concerned about the cost, it's always a good idea to consult with a qualified practitioner who can provide an accurate quote based on your specific case.
2. Myth: Liquid nose jobs are not long-lasting
Fact: Many people believe that the results of a liquid nose job are temporary and will only last for a short period. While it's true that dermal fillers are not permanent, the effects of a liquid nose job can last anywhere from six months to two years, depending on the type of filler used and individual factors.
Semi-permanent fillers, such as hyaluronic acid-based products, are commonly used for liquid nose jobs. They provide natural-looking results and can be easily dissolved if desired. However, keep in mind that individual results may vary, and touch-up sessions may be required to maintain the desired outcome.
3. Myth: Liquid nose jobs are a one-size-fits-all solution
Fact: Another misconception is that liquid nose jobs offer limited options and are not suitable for everyone. In reality, while a liquid nose job can address certain concerns, it's important to understand that it's not a substitute for surgical rhinoplasty.
Liquid nose jobs are ideal for individuals who wish to improve the shape, symmetry, or contour of their nose, correct small irregularities, or enhance the appearance without major changes. However, if you have more complex concerns, such as a deviated septum or significant structural issues, surgical intervention may be a better option.
It's crucial to consult with a qualified professional who can evaluate your specific needs and determine whether a liquid nose job is suitable for you.

5. Myth: Insurance will cover the cost of a liquid nose job
Fact: In most cases, liquid nose jobs are considered cosmetic procedures and are not covered by insurance. Insurance coverage typically applies to procedures that address medical conditions or functional impairments rather than those performed for aesthetic purposes.
It's crucial to check with your insurance provider to understand their policy regarding liquid nose jobs or any other cosmetic procedures you may be considering. They will be able to provide you with accurate information and help you determine the best course of action.
6. Myth: Liquid nose jobs are painful
Fact: One of the reasons liquid nose jobs have gained popularity is the minimal discomfort associated with the procedure. Topical or local anesthesia is applied to the treatment area to ensure a comfortable experience for the patient.
While every individual's pain tolerance is different, most people report feeling only mild discomfort or pressure during the procedure. Afterward, any discomfort is typically temporary and can be effectively managed with over-the-counter pain relievers, if necessary.

10. Myth: Liquid nose jobs have no risks or potential side effects
Fact: As with any medical procedure, liquid nose jobs do carry some risks. However, they are generally considered safe when performed by a qualified and experienced practitioner.
Common side effects may include redness, swelling, bruising, or tenderness around the injection site. These effects are usually temporary and subside within a few days or weeks.
It's important to choose a provider who prioritizes safety, follows proper sterilization techniques, and has experience in performing liquid nose jobs to minimize the risk of complications.

3. What if I change my mind after getting a liquid nose job?
If you're unhappy with the results of your liquid nose job or change your mind, don't worry! Unlike surgical rhinoplasty, liquid nose jobs are reversible. The filler used can be dissolved with the help of an enzyme called hyaluronidase, returning your nose to its pre-treatment appearance.
